Seoul: The Heartbeat of Korea
Our adventure begins in Seoul, the pulsating capital city that seamlessly blends ancient traditions with modern dynamism. First stop: Gyeongbokgung Palace, the grandest of Seoul's five grand palaces. Imagine yourself wandering through its majestic gates, exploring ornate courtyards, and witnessing the changing of the guard ceremony – a truly spectacular sight! Pro-tip: Arrive early to avoid crowds and snag the best photo opportunities. Don't forget to explore the beautiful Secret Garden hidden within the palace walls – a tranquil oasis amidst the bustling city.
Next, immerse yourself in the trendy streets of Gangnam, made famous by Psy's iconic song. This district is a haven for luxury shopping, upscale restaurants, and dazzling nightlife. But beyond the glitz and glamour, you'll find charming cafes, hidden alleyways brimming with street art, and the serene COEX Aquarium, perfect for a relaxing afternoon.
No trip to Seoul is complete without visiting Namsan Hanok Village, a beautifully preserved traditional Korean village. Here, you can explore charming hanoks (traditional houses), sample delicious street food, and experience a slower pace of life. For breathtaking panoramic views of the city, ascend N Seoul Tower, located atop Namsan Mountain. The cable car ride itself is an adventure, offering stunning vistas along the way.

Busan: The Coastal Jewel
Head south to Busan, a vibrant coastal city known for its stunning beaches, bustling fish markets, and colorful temples. Haeundae Beach is the perfect place to relax on the sand, take a refreshing dip in the ocean, or enjoy the lively beachside atmosphere. Explore the labyrinthine alleys of Gamcheon Culture Village, a charming hillside community adorned with colorful houses and captivating street art. For a unique experience, visit the Jagalchi Fish Market, where you can witness the vibrant energy of the fishermen and even sample some fresh seafood.
Jeju Island: Volcanic Beauty and Natural Wonders
Escape to Jeju Island, a volcanic island paradise off the southern coast of Korea. Explore the dramatic volcanic landscapes, hike along scenic coastal trails, and marvel at the stunning natural beauty. Seongsan Ilchulbong Peak (Sunrise Peak) offers breathtaking sunrise views, while the Manjanggul Lava Tube is a fascinating geological wonder. Relax on the pristine beaches, delve into the lush forests, and discover the island's unique culture and history.
DMZ: A Glimpse into History
For a more poignant and thought-provoking experience, consider a visit to the Demilitarized Zone (DMZ), the border between North and South Korea. This heavily fortified area offers a sobering glimpse into the Korean War and the ongoing division of the peninsula. Guided tours provide historical context and insights into the geopolitical situation.
Insider Tips for Your Korean Adventure:
• Transportation: South Korea boasts an efficient and affordable public transportation system. Utilize the subway and buses to navigate easily between cities and attractions.
• Accommodation: Choose from a wide range of accommodation options, from traditional hanoks to modern hotels and guesthouses. Consider staying in a hanok for a truly authentic experience.
• Food: Korean cuisine is a delicious adventure in itself! Indulge in bibimbap, bulgogi, kimchi, and countless other culinary delights. Don't be afraid to try street food – it's often some of the best!
• Language: While English is spoken in tourist areas, learning a few basic Korean phrases will enhance your interactions with locals.
• Culture: Korea is a country rich in traditions and customs. Take the time to learn about Korean etiquette and customs to show respect and appreciation for the local culture.
